1、同步性:vector是线程安全的,也是就是说是同步的,而Arraylist是线程不安全的,不是同步的。
2、数据增长:当需要增长时verctor默认增长为原来的一倍,而Arraylist却是原来的一半。
2、数据增长:当需要增长时verctor默认增长为原来的一倍,而Arraylist却是原来的一半。
本文探讨了Java中Vector与ArrayList的区别,主要聚焦于两者的同步性和数据增长方式的不同。Vector是线程安全且同步的,而ArrayList则不具备这些特性;此外,在需要扩容时,Vector会将容量增加一倍,ArrayList则只会增加原有容量的一半。
355
2万+

被折叠的 条评论
为什么被折叠?